University of Minnesota-Duluth

University of Minnesota-Duluth is a medium, public institution located in Duluth, mn. University of Minnesota-Duluth offers undergraduate degrees in 133 majors.

Annual tuition & cost

In state

Undergraduate tuition $14,126
Additional expenses
Room & board $9,638
Books & supplies $1,000
Other expenses $2,444
Cost of attendance* $27,208
Average financial aid package N/A
Average net price $27,208 See my potential costs

Out of state

Undergraduate tuition $19,516
Additional expenses
Room & board $9,638
Books & supplies $1,000
Other expenses $2,444
Cost of attendance* $32,598
Average financial aid package N/A
Average net price $32,598 See my potential costs
